Transaction af221a20669e57a5ee44ded181a6b7a8d5146fcf40ce367c793f9327dbc190c1
1 Input
1 Output
-
af221a20669e57a5ee44ded181a6b7a8d5146fcf40ce367c793f9327dbc190c1:0
- value
- 572838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 000c580f10931a7d08b52e612580320c4aef851c OP_EQUAL
- address
- 31hGiDdKpKE4uXLnfBjdocS7WT3ErMusj5